The contribution of plain x-rays to the management of posterior fossa disease in the CT era.

E W Radue, G H du Boulay.   

Abstract

The contribution of plain X-rays to the management of 170 patients suspected or actually found to have posterior fossa disease has been retrospectively assessed. A useful contribution was made in 4%.
